Stand-alone solar PV mini-grids or solar PV-hybrid mini-grids have installed costs in Africa ranging from USD 1.9 to USD 5.9/W for systems greater than 200 kW. Solar PV mini-grids that came online in 2012 or earlier have higher costs.
With the fall in solar PV costs, solar PV mini-grids ofer important economic opportunities today as either the sole source of generation or in hybrid configuration with other generation sources.
The Kenya Renewable Energy Association also pointed out that, “The average solar PV system size for households in Kenya is 25-30Wp. The typical cost of installed systems is about 12 USD/Wp installed” (KEREA, n.d.).
Battery costs varied widely, depending on the size of the battery and the project, from a low of USD 0.1/W to USD 4.1/W for the most expensive. For mini-grids without batteries, solar PV modules account for 11-64% of total installed costs, and the simple average is around 44% (Figure 32).
The cost range was between USD 3.4 and USD 6.9/W in 2012, declining to USD 2.4 to USD 5.5/W in 2013 and to USD 2 to USD 4.9/W in 2014 (Figure ES 1). For 2015 to 2016, the cost range is anticipated to be between USD 1.3/W and USD 4.1/W.
Solar PV module costs for these systems were between USD 0.8 and USD 2.8/W for seven of the projects, but USD 6.3/W for one project.
